Fats are made up of a glycerol backbone and 3 fatty acids. Glycerol: used as a food supplement to enhance performance, attained/made in the diet, also made in body when you eat other things. Cho one of the intermediates can be turned into glycerol: you can form glucose from glycerol. If you are to supplement with glycerol, you can convert this to glucose if cho is limiting to your performance: when you consume a large amount of water with glycerol.
